#4ffbd0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ffbd0 is composed of 31% red, 98.4%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.1%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 165 degrees, a saturation of 95.6% and a lightness of 64.7%. #4ffbd0 color hex could be obtained by blending #9effff with #00f7a1.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#4ffbd0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4ffbd0 has RGB values of R:79, G:251,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 5241808.

Shades and Tints of #4ffbd0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00100c is the darkest color, while #fcfffe is the lightest one.
